Pharmaxo Healthcare is seeking a dedicated individual for a full-time role in their aseptic unit in Corsham, UK.
Responsibilities include participating in aseptic activities, labeling, and packaging medicines.
Ideal candidates are motivated, reliable, and possess strong attention to detail.
This position offers an annual salary of £26,064 along with 25 days of annual leave, company bonus, and additional benefits such as pension and life assurance.
Training opportunities for career progression are available.
